Chinese vendor offers RTX 4090 cheaper than RTX 5090
A Chinese company has started selling a new version of the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090 graphics card with 48 GB of VRAM. This version is priced lower than the newer RTX 5090 and comes with water cooling. The RTX 4090 with 48 GB VRAM is intended for high-performance computing, especially for tasks that require more memory, like artificial intelligence. A user on Reddit shared pictures of this graphics card, showing a cooling system that includes three fans and a radiator. The packaging clearly states that it is the "GeForce RTX 4090 48 GB." This graphics card features the same GPU architecture as the original RTX 4090, which includes 16,384 CUDA cores and GDDR6X memory. Although the new version has a larger memory capacity, it does not have higher memory speeds. However, the increased VRAM can improve performance in certain complex tasks. The price for the RTX 4090 48 GB is around $3,400. Despite being more affordable than the RTX 5090, finding the latter at its suggested retail price may be challenging. In addition, there are rumors that a version with 96 GB of memory may be released soon, although it is not finalized yet.
